£106,950 per year

Based on an annual salary of £106,950, your estimated take home pay is £71,893 after tax and National Insurance, giving you £5,991 per month

Yearly Monthly Weekly Daily
Basic Salary £106,950.00 £8,912.50 £2,056.73 £411.35
Taxable Income £97,855.00 £8,154.58 £1,881.83 £376.37
Income Tax £30,907.00 £2,575.58 £594.37 £118.87
National Insurance £4,149.60 £345.80 £79.80 £15.96
Take Home Pay £71,893.40 £5,991.12 £1,382.57 £276.51
Calculation Assumptions

To give you an idea of what you'd bring home after taxes, we based our calculations on these assumptions:

  • You are an employee, not a company director.
  • You don't get paid dividends (a share of company profits).
  • Your salary is spread out in equal payments throughout the year.
  • You haven't reached retirement age yet and don't receive a state pension.
  • You don't pay Scottish income tax (this applies to people in Scotland).
  • Your National Insurance (NI) category is A, H & M (this is a standard category for most employees).
  • You only pay Class 1 National Insurance (this is paid by most employees).
  • Your tax code is likely 1257L, which is typical for someone with one job or pension.
  • This information about your take-home pay doesn't include any money going towards a pension.
